#14df19 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#14df19 is composed of 7.8% red, 87.5%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.8%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 121.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 47.6%. #14df19 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ff32 with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#14df19

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010701 is the darkest color, while #f4f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#14df19

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#718272 is the less saturated color, while #01f207 is the most saturated one.
